The Globular Clusters of Barnard's Galaxy
Barnard's Galaxy has 9 known globular clusters. Here I have used PixInsight to annotate my image with the 5 globulars that lie within the image FOV:
SC3, SC5, SC6, Hubble-VII and Hubble-VIII.
Image details:
Date: 29th and 30th July, 3rd, 22nd, and 23rd August 2017 + 7th, 18th, 19th, 26th and 27th July 2012
Exposure: Ha L R G B: 285:1145:114:112:112m, total 29hrs 28mins @ -25/-30C
Telescope: Homebuilt 12.5" f/4 Serrurier Truss Newtonian (2017) and Homebuilt 10" Serrurier Truss Newtonian f/5 (2012)
Camera: QSI 683wsg with Lodestar guider
Filters: Astrodon LRGB E-Series Gen 2 and 3nm H-Alpha
Taken from my observatory in Auckland, New Zealand
